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Whyteleafe to Bearsden start from as little as £58.00

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Whyteleafe to Bearsden start from £129.40 one way, or £184.90 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Whyteleafe to Bearsden are available for £204.70 one way, or £409.40 return

Station Facilities and Customer Support

Whyteleafe station is committed to making your journey smooth and accessible. The ticket office operates Monday to Friday from 05:55 to 12:30, and on Saturdays from 06:20 to 12:25, making it easy to buy and collect your tickets. Additionally, handy ticket machines are accessible for purchasing tickets, including those with Disabled Persons Railcard discounts, ensuring all visitors can find the right tickets for their needs.

The station is fortified with CCTV for your safety and includes help points on platforms, offering assistance around the clock. Although there's no luggage storage or refreshments services available, the station does offer basic amenities, like seating areas and a few accessible spaces in its 124-space car park managed by APCOA Parking UK. While there is no dedicated waiting room, step-free access to platforms means it's user-friendly for passengers with limited mobility.

Facilities and Amenities

Bearsden Train Station is well-equipped for those early morning commutes or day trips. Ticket offices are available from 07:00 to 14:04, Monday through Saturday, and ticket machines ensure you can collect your pre-purchased tickets anytime. The station is also geared towards accessibility, featuring step-free access to certain areas, induction loops, and accessible ticket machines.

While the station lacks a few conveniences such as refreshment facilities, ATMs, or shops, it compensates with essentials like seating areas and an ample car park with 92 spaces, including free parking. Note that if you need assistance, there's staff help available primarily on Mondays, and customer help points to ensure a smooth journey.

Connecting Transport Options

For onward travel, Bearsden offers several options. Public buses stop on Main Road, allowing easy connections to nearby destinations. Taxi services are also readily available and conveniently bookable online through Train Taxi (traintaxi.co.uk). With reliable connections to the broader transport network, you're never stranded at Bearsden.

You can find further detailed bus service information on Travelinescotland or by calling 0871 200 22 33, a handy resource for organizing your journey with confidence.
